Warning Signs You Need Temperature-Controlled Drying

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to further damage and even more costly repairs. Don’t wait until it’s too late. Our team is here to help you identify and address these signs before they become a bigger problem.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Musty od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ly. Our team can help you identify the cause and provide a solution.

Water Stains or Warping on Floors or Walls

Water stains or warping on floors or walls can be a sign of underlying moisture damage. If you notice these signs, it’s crucial to address the issue before it leads to further damage.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of excess moisture in the area.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age. Our team can help you identify the cause and provide a solution.

Visible Mold or Mildew Growth

Visible mold or mildew growth is a sign that the environment is too humid or wet. If you notice these signs,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age. Our team can help you identify the cause and provide a solution.

Unpleasant Odors or Slime in Fixtures

Unpleasant odors or slime in fixtures can show the presence of bacteria or mildew.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age. Our team can help you identify the cause and provide a solution.

Temperature-Controlled Drying vs. DIY: When to Call a Pro

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ill on hardwood floor Yes No DIY methods are usually enough for small spills.
Large water damage in multiple rooms No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are required to handle large-scale damage.
Water damage in sensitive areas like electronics or artwork No Yes Specialized equipment and techniques are required to handle sensitive areas.
Musty odors or mold growth in attic or crawl space No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are required to address hidden damage.
Water damage in a commercial building No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are required to handle large-scale commercial damage.

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ost in Pantego, TX

The cost of Temperature-Controlled Drying can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a customized estimate based on your specific situation. Here are some estimated costs for common Temperature-Controlled Drying services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$200 – $500 Severity of damage and size of affected area
Equipment Deployment and Temperature Control $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Drying and Cleanup $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and complexity of damage
Final Inspection and Certification $200 – $500 Severity of damage and size of affected area

Keep in mind that these are estimated costs, and the final price will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an that fits your budget and needs.
